A 55-year-old man suffered burns when attempting to light a pilot light in a pizza oven Monday morning at Chefs of Napoli restaurant in Wildwood.

Sumter County Fire & EMS and the Villages Public Safety Department were called at 9:27 a.m. to the restaurant on U.S. 301 after the flash fire broke out.

The man was transported to UF Shands Hospital in Gainesville with minor burns. There was no damage to the restaurant. After inspection and clearance from the fire prevention bureau, the business was allowed to continue operation.
